Output 66b8a38c8590d9b05197f0849ea91b006831b8195af71bc98d12fca857880150:0

value
90745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78d6c5e0ea64c5e0df716d7b99e13c1e6ed10147 OP_EQUAL
address
3ChxJFUvzVMi5xPFXy74NDasqA98NfLi9m
transaction
66b8a38c8590d9b05197f0849ea91b006831b8195af71bc98d12fca857880150
spent
true